Security trade-offs deserve a whole conversation. Whoa! Alright, breathe—this matters. Multi-chain wallets with exchange linkage must be audited, clear about key custody, and transparent in fallback procedures. If a product obfuscates withdrawal flows or hides signs of permissioned custodianship, that part bugs me; I’m biased, but traders should demand audit proofs and clear UX for signing intent. Also, remember hardware-wallet compatibility—if you can’t export a seed or sign through a ledger, that’s a red flag.

When shopping for a wallet that ties to an exchange, look for three things. Here’s the thing. First, multi-chain support with robust routing and sensible gas estimation. Second, integrated trading tools—order types, risk metrics, P/L visibility. Third, clear connectivity to CEX rails so deposits and withdrawals don’t become a day’s work. If those boxes are checked, you get speed, breadth, and a clearer mental model for where liquidity lives.

Let me be practical for a second. Hmm… my go-to approach is to keep trading capital in the exchange-linked layer for market ops, while keeping longer-term positions in self-custody on-chain. That split reduces exposure to exchange operational risks while maintaining fast access to liquidity when I need it. Some folks take the opposite approach and that’s fine—there’s no single right way. I’m not 100% sure which is objectively best; it depends on your time horizon and risk tolerance, and there’s room for experimentation.

There are trade-offs you should plan for. Whoa! Fees can pop up in two places—exchange fees and on-chain gas—and your strategy needs to model both. Tools that show estimated round-trip costs help avoid surprises. Also, tax and compliance tracking gets messy when you hop chains and platforms; a wallet that exports transaction histories in clear formats is very very important. And yeah, expect some UX rough edges early on—products like this evolve fast and sometimes messy features arrive first, polished ones later.

How to Evaluate These Wallets

Start small and test flows with nominal funds. Whoa! Seriously—use micro-trades to confirm settlement times and fee estimates. Look for clear documentation, hardware-wallet compatibility, and audit reports if available. If a wallet offers both on-chain DeFi and exchange rails, stress-test both paths because bridging assumptions can break in edge cases. I’m biased toward interfaces that let me see every API call and signature step, because transparency builds trust.

FAQ

Can I trade across chains without moving assets through a bridge?

Short answer: sometimes. Really? Some wallets use exchange custody as an intermediate to instantly move value between chains without you manually bridging, while others rely on smart routing and fast bridges. My experience is that the hybrid models reduce manual friction and save time, though they do introduce custodial considerations you should understand before trusting large balances.

Is this safe for active traders?

It can be, if you pick the right product. Whoa! Security depends on audits, key management, UX clarity, and recoverability. Keep small working balances on the integrated layer and move larger holdings to cold or hardware storage when possible; that simple split mitigates many of the operational risks.
